抄録

In this study, dry-type reduction of mercury (II) chloride experiments were conducted using a packed bed with granular tin metal. The purpose of this study was to identify factors effecting the dry-type reduction process and to elucidate the reaction mechanism. In the reduction of mercury (II) chloride, the ratio of chlorinated surface area on tin was a vital factor. Precoating the surface of granular tin metal with 1N hydrochloric acid was effective in maintaining the reducibility. Marcury (II) chloride was reduced to mercury (0) vapor by the following two reactions on the chlorinated surface of tin metal.<BR>SnCl2 (s) + HgCl2 (g)→SnCl4 (g) + Hg (g)<BR>SnCl2 (s) + HgCl2 (g) + 2H20 (g)→SnO2 (s) + Hg (g) + 4HCl (g)<BR>Also, it is presumed that decreased reducibility was the result of the following oxidative reactions with tin (II) chloride.<BR>SnCl2 (s) + H2O (g)→SnO (s) + 2HCl (g)<BR>SnCl2 (s) + H2O (g) + 1/2O2 (g)→SnO (s) + 2HCl (g)
